Dear Gardeners!
Bramshott Liphook and District Horticultural Society have a programme of speakers for 2009 and the first this year is on Thursday 15th January at 7.45pm at the Church Centre, Portsmouth Road.
The speaker is Alan Martin talking about Wierd and Wonderful Plants.
There will be refreshments and a raffle and all visitors will be made welcome. Please pop along for an interesting talk and to find out more about the society. New members always welcome!
